Cal. Code Regs. Tit. 16, § 1223 - Embalming, Preparation and Storage Rooms
(a) No embalming, preparation or storage room
shall be located in any public storage, mini-storage, mini-warehouse,
multi-unit storage complex or similar facility used by members of the general
public for the storage of goods. Any existing embalming, preparation or storage
room located in a prohibited facility shall be relocated and brought into full
compliance with this section, within twelve (12) months of this subsection's
effective date.
(b) Every licensed
funeral establishment shall maintain in its embalming, preparation and/or
storage room, a sufficient supply of a suitable and effective disinfectant to
provide for the cleansing and disinfection of the facility and its
contents.
(c) Every licensed
funeral establishment and funeral director who holds unembalmed human remains
for a period longer than twenty-four (24) hours shall cause the body to be
refrigerated at an approved facility with sufficient capacity as defined under
section 1223.1(d).
(d) All embalming, preparation or storage
rooms shall contain only the equipment and supplies necessary for the
preparation or care and handling of human remains for disposition or
transportation.
(e) As used in this
chapter, a storage room is a suitable room, other than a chapel, viewing or
visitation room, office, supply room, closet or other room open to public
access, which is used by a licensed funeral establishment for the storage or
holding of human remains prior to effecting disposition. A storage room may be
maintained in conjunction with an embalming or preparation room.
